A JOURNALIST has been arrested on suspicion of computer hacking in a case which is believed to involve a former Lancashire police officer.
The 28-year-old man is understood to be the former Times journalist Patrick Foster.
It is understood the arrest relates to a Scotland Yard investigation into the hacking of the email account of Lancashire detective Richard Horton in 2009, which unmasked him as the author of the anonymous NightJack blog.
Foster is the 11th person to be arrested by detectives from Operation Tuleta, the Metropolitan Police investigation of breaches of privacy, which is running alongside the phone-hacking scandal investigation, Operation Weeting.
